Analysis

Costa Rica recorded 15.0% for uis: percentage of population age 25+ whose highest level of in 2018.

The figure is down 0.8% on the previous year and up 4.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, uis: percentage of population age 25+ whose highest level of in Costa Rica peaked at 15.1% in 2016 and was at its lowest, 6.1%, in 1973.

Costa Rica ranks 44th of 88 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 11 years of available data.

UIS: Percentage of population age 25+ whose highest level of in Costa Rica, year by year

Annual values for UIS: Percentage of population age 25+ whose highest level of education is lower secondary, male in Costa Rica, 1973 to 2018.
Year Value Change
1973 6.1%
2007 14.3% +136.5%
2008 14.4% +0.5%
2009 14.2% -1.7%
2010 13.8% -2.5%
2011 14.0% +1.5%
2012 14.1% +0.4%
2014 14.4% +2.4%
2015 15.1% +4.6%
2016 15.1% +0.5%
2018 15.0% -0.8%

The percentage of male population (age 25 and over) with completed lower secondary education (ISCED 2) as the highest level of educational attainment. This indicator is calculated by dividing the number of males aged 25 years and above who completed lower secondary education as the highest level of educational attainment by the total male population of the same age group and multiplying the result by 100. The UNESCO Institute for Statistics (UIS) educational attainment dataset shows the educational composition of the population aged 25 years and above and hence the stock and quality of human capital within a country. The dataset also reflects the structure and performance of the education system and its accumulated impact on human capital formation.
